Re: Liebherr LTM 1030-2
Quote:
Have you thought about a DX8 spektrum. 8 channels and model select. This is when you change the model program on transmitter it will select the reciever you bound to that program. Which means you can have 3 separate servo circuits with 8 channels each. 1: Truck 2: Legs/stabilisers (allows for individual motion) 3: Crane. (means no need for cables or contact disk for power/control up the centre. |
